At promptly 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day, June 15, chapter president Dick Towle started the Auburn chapter's June meeting with a welcome and introduction of new members and guests.
    Dick demonstrated Spell Catcher which resides on the task bar and responds immediately when typing a word that is incorrect, giving one the opportunity of correcting immediately, rather than waiting until finished and then performing a spell check, which is an option if one wishes to do batch spell checking. This program includes scientific, medial, legal, and HTML dictionaries. Spell Catcher also contains a thesaurus. A $59 copy of this program was won by one of our members, as were many other prizes.


    

    Dick also demonstrated ZTree, a replacement (and improvement) for the no-longer- available XTree. One of the questions asked early in the Beginners SIG was how to copy longer files than would fit on a 1.44 MB floppy disk, and one answer was to utilize the split-file utility of ZTree. This feature lets the user put in disks until ZTree finishes saving the file across several disks. When you copy the floppy, ZTree automatically prompts you to put in subsequent disks until the entire file has been copied.
